比特币作为一种去中心化的数字货币,利用区块链技术,实现了安全快速的交易。而比特币钱包则是用户存储、发送和接收比特币的工具。生成比特币钱包的一个重要环节就是使用随机数来确保其安全性。那么,如何使用随机数来生成比特币钱包呢?下面就为大家详细介绍这一过程。

随机数的概念

随机数是计算机科学中的一个重要概念,它是一种不可预测的数字序列。对于加密货币而言,随机数不仅用来生成钱包地址,还用于生成私钥,确保每个用户的钱包的独特性及安全性。随机数的质量直接影响到钱包的安全性,劣质的随机数可能导致钱包被轻易破解。

比特币钱包的类型

在深入探讨如何使用随机数生成比特币钱包之前,我们先了解一下比特币钱包的几种主要类型。首先是热钱包,它通常在线,并且容易使用,适合频繁交易。其次是冷钱包,通常通过硬件或纸质形式保存,不连接互联网,安全性极高。最后是桌面钱包和移动钱包,前者安装在电脑上,后者则是手机应用。这些钱包的选择会影响到随机数生成和私钥的保护策略。

如何生成比特币钱包

生成比特币钱包的步骤通常包含以下几个环节:

  1. 选择一个加密货币钱包软件或工具,确保其可信度和安全性。
  2. 生成随机数。大多数钱包软件会结合高质量的随机数生成算法来创建地址和私钥,确保其唯一性和不可预测性。
  3. 将生成的私钥保存到安全的地方。私钥如同你的银行密码,若被他人获取,将可能导致你的资产丢失。
  4. 创建钱包地址并进行备份,这个地址将用于接收比特币。
  5. 定期更新软件版本和应用安全设置,并关注不明来源的交易。

随机数生成的安全性

生成高质量的随机数是确保比特币钱包安全的关键。大多数现代的钱包生成工具采用安全随机数生成器(CSPRNG)技术。该技术基于物理现象(如热噪声)或复杂算法,确保生成的随机数深不可测。此外,用户也可以选择使用硬件随机数生成器,在物理上隔离生成过程,从而提高安全性。

可能出现的风险

尽管采用随机数生成钱包的过程能够提供较高的安全保障,但用户仍需注意平台的选择。使用不知名或不安全的软件可能导致私钥被窃取。此外,用户在使用公共网络或不安全设备时,钱包的安全性也会受到威胁。因此,建立良好的使用习惯,定期更换私钥和使用切勿重复的随机数尤为重要。

相关问题

如何选择安全的比特币钱包软件?

选择安全的比特币钱包软件的过程中,有几个要点需要注意:

  • 社区口碑和评分:查询用户的评论和分享,看软件的使用体验如何。
  • 安全性评测:查看软件是否开放源代码,是否经过安全审计,这些都能增加信任感。
  • 设计和用户体验:选择直观且易于操作的软件,有助于避免误操作及提升交易效率。
  • 更新频率:软件是否定期更新,以紧跟技术进步和安全漏洞修复。

比特币钱包的备份与恢复方法

备份比特币钱包是确保资产安全不可或缺的一步。用户可以采用多种方式进行备份。

  • 纸质备份:将私钥和钱包地址抄写在纸上并保存在安全的地方,是一种古老但有效的备份方式。
  • 加密存储:将钱包文件或私钥加密后存储在USB驱动器等外部设备上,确保远离网络威胁。
  • 云备份:一些云存储服务允许用户进行加密备份,但需谨慎选择,确保其可靠性。

恢复钱包的过程通常需要用户输入其私钥或助记词。确保输入的环境安全,避免信息泄露。

为什么使用冷钱包更安全?

冷钱包的安全性体现在几个方面:首先,它不与互联网连接,极大地减少了被黑客攻击的风险。即使用户电脑遭受病毒攻击,冷钱包中的比特币也不会受到威胁。其次,冷钱包通常采用了高质量的随机数生成和私钥管理方式,增强了资产的安全性。尽管使用冷钱包进行交易时不够便捷,但对于长时间储存比特币,它是更安全的选择。

如何保护比特币钱包免受盗窃?

保护比特币钱包的软件和硬件环境至关重要。用户应定期更新操作系统和钱包软件的版本,确保漏洞及时修复。此外,使用强密码和二次验证功能可以有效提升账户的安全性。定期监测钱包的活动及异常交易,及时排查潜在威胁。同时,用户应避免在公共网络环境下进行交易,确保数据安全。

通过上述介绍,相信读者对随机数生成比特币钱包的过程有了更清晰的认识。生成并保护好比特币钱包,做好备份,以及选择适合自己的钱包软件,都是保障资产安全的重要步骤。希望这些信息能对广大比特币用户有所帮助。